﻿@media screen and (max-width: 989px)
{
    #google_image_div, #GHeader_main2, #Globes_Footer, #passMadadim, div[id^='div-gpt-ad'], .BTN-ReadMore
		{
        display: none !important;
		}
}

@media screen and (min-width: 640px) and (max-width: 989px)
{
    #left {
        width: 100% !important;
        margin-top: 26px;
        }
    .SeprateSpace
        {
        display:none;
        }
    #page-wrap, #GPage_main
		{
        width: 640px;
		}
    #main
		{
        width: 640px;
        display: block;
        margin: 0 auto;
		}
    #main #LogoBox
		{
        background-size: 100%;
        margin: 0;
        height: 70px;
		}
    .BigSlider
		{
        width: 100%;
        min-height: 315px;
        height: 100%;
        }
    .ImagesLayer a img 
	    {
        width:100%;
        max-width:639px;
        height: 100%;
        }
    .BigSlider
		{ 
		max-height: 170px;
		width:100%;
		margin-bottom:20px !important;
		} 
    .BTNsLayer 
        {
        height:40%;
        width:10%;
        position: absolute;
        top: 30%;
        z-index: 2;
        cursor: pointer;
        } 
    .BTNsLayer 
        {
        height: 55px;
        width: 40px;
        }
    #IgolimBigSlider 
        {
        left:40%;
        position: absolute;
        bottom: 0px;
        z-index: 2;
        } 
    #footerN_main, #footer_globes
		{
        display: none;
		}
    #left
		{
        width: 100% !important;
        margin-top: 26px;
		}
    #madrih 
        {
        border-bottom: 1px solid #EFEFEF;
        border-bottom: 1px solid #EFEFEF;
        float: left;
        width: 50%;
        }
   #NewsletterBox 
        {
        background: #EEF8F6;
        display: block;
        width: 45%;
        float: right;
        }
    #TVArticleBox
        {
        clear:both;
        }
    .template_clipBox .ReadMoreClipBox 
        {
        float: right;
        width: 50%;
        }
   #form-box-div
		{
        width: 100%;
		}
    .input-Box
		{
        width:99%;
        clear: none;
        float: right;
		}
    .input-Box:nth-of-type(2n)
		{
        float: left;
		}
    #DetailsBox p
		{
        clear: both;
		}
    #DetailsBox
		{
        width: 96%;
		}
    .checkbox-Box
		{
        float: right;
        width: 45%;
		}
    .send-btn-div
		{
        width: 100% !important;
		}
    .checkbox-Box:nth-of-type(2n)
		{
        float: left;
		}
    .Control_04 > h3
		{
        margin: 0 0 40px 0px;
        width: 48%;
		}
    #video_5sconds > a > img
		{
        float: right;
		}
    #video_5sconds > a > div
		{
        float: left;
        width: 48%;
		}
	#LogoBox
	    {    
	    height: 55px;
        background-size: 86%;
	    }
    #articles #GlobesViewer	.RandomalArticle 
	    {
        width: 46%;
        float: right;
        margin-left:0;
        }
	#articles #GlobesViewer .RandomalArticle:nth-of-type(2n) 
	    {
        float:left;
        clear:left;
        }	
    ._RandomalIndexLinkBox		    
        {
        float:right;
        }
    ._RandomalIndexLinkBox	+  .RandomalArticle	    
        {
        float:left !important;
        clear:left !important;
        }
    #MadorArticles .Control_04
        {
        width:100%;
        }
    #MadorArticles .Control_04 h3
        {
        width:100%;
        }        
    #MadorArticles .Control_04 h3 > a > img
        {
        max-width:300px;
        width:100%;
        height:auto;
        }
    #MadorArticles .Control_04 .title, #MadorArticles .Control_04 .subtitle
        {
        width:45%;
        }
    #DetailsBox label
        {
        width: auto;
        float: none;
        }
    #DetailsBox input, #DetailsBox textarea
        {
        width:95% !important;            
        float: none;
        }
    #madrih .SeprateSpace
        {
        display:block;
        }
    #leftside-controls-responsive-box
        {
        float: right;
        }
    #leftside-controls-responsive-box .SeprateSpace
        {
        display:block;
        }    
}

/*@media screen and (min-width:320px) and (max-width: 639px)*/
@media screen and (max-width: 639px)
{

    #footerN_main, #footer_globes
        {
        display:none;
        }
    #page-wrap, #GPage_main
		{
        width:100%;
		}
    #main
		{
        width:100%;
        display: block;
        margin: 0 auto;
		}
    #main #LogoBox
		{
        background-size: 100%;
        margin: 0;
        height: 70px;
		}
	#LogoBox 
		{
		background: url('http://images.globes.co.il/images/site2/special_projects/small_business/logo3.jpg') repeat-x;
		width: 100%;
		 
		background-size: 100%;
		}
	.ImagesLayer a img 
	    {
        width:100%;
        max-width: 320px !important;
        height:auto;
        max-height:138px;
        }
    .BigSlider
		{ 
		max-height: 170px;
		width:100%;
		margin-bottom:0 !important;
		} 
    .BTNsLayer 
        {
        height:25%;
        width:10%;
        position: absolute;
        top: 30%;
        z-index: 2;
        cursor: pointer;
        } 
    #IgolimBigSlider 
        {
        left: 25%;
        position: absolute;
        bottom: 0px;
        z-index: 2;
        }              
	#right
		{
		margin-top:10px;
		}
    #main #left
		{
        width: 100%;
		}
    #form-box-div
		{
        width: 100%;
		}
    .input-Box
        {
        width:97%;
        clear: both;
        float: none;        
		}
	.input-Box:not(.send-btn-div)
		{
		background:#fff; 
		}
	.input-Box:not(.send-btn-div) input
		{
		float:right !important;
		width:60% !important; 
		}
	.input-Box #VJob
	    {
	    right:100px !important;
	    width:65% !important; 
	    background-position:10px 1px !important;
	    padding:0 !important;
	    }
    .input-Box:nth-of-type(2n)
		{
        float: none;
		}
    #DetailsBox p
		{	
        clear: both;
		}
    #DetailsBox
		{
        width: 96%;
		}
    .checkbox-Box
		{
        float: none;
        width: 100%;
		}
    .send-btn-div
		{
        width: 100% !important;
		}
    .checkbox-Box:nth-of-type(2n)
		{
        float: left;
		}
    .Control_04 > h3
		{
        margin: 0 0 20px 0px;
        width: 100%;
		}
    #video_5sconds > a > img
		{
        float: right;
		}
    #video_5sconds > a > div
		{
        float: left;
        width: 48%;
		}
    #main #right
        {
        width: 96%;
        padding: 0 2%;
        }
    #TopArticles
		{
        width: 100%;
		}
    #TopArticles a.Control_01
		{
        position: static;
		}		
		
    #TopArticles .title, #TopArticles .subtitle, #TopArticles a:first-child
		{
        float: none;
        width: 100%;
		}
    #TopArticles .title
		{
        margin-top: 20px;
		}
    .Control_04 > h3 .title
		{
        min-height: 60px;
		}
    #cooperation .Control_04 > h3
		{
        margin: 0 0 20px 0px !important;
		}
    #cooperation .Control_04 > h3:nth-of-type(2n)
		{
        float: left;
		}
    #cooperation .Control_04 > h3:nth-child(4n)
		{
        float: right !important;
		}
    #cooperation .Control_04 > h3:nth-child(3n)
		{
        margin:0 0 20px 0px !important;
        float: left;
		}
    #video_5sconds > a > div
		{
        float: none;
        width: 100%;
        margin: 20px 0;
        display: block;
        overflow: hidden;
		}
    #TVArticleBox .Control_04 .title
		{
        min-height: 20px;
        font: normal 0.9rem/1.1rem arial;
		}
    #main #LogoBox
		{
        height:70px;
		}

    #MenuBar
		{
        background: url('http://images.globes.co.il/images/Site2/special_projects/tama38/menu_icon.png') no-repeat right top;
        cursor: pointer;
		width:98%;		
		}
    #MenuBar:hover ul
		{
        display: block;
        background: #333;
        width: 96%;
        height: 218px;
        position: absolute;
        z-index: 2;
        margin-top: 30px;
        }
    #MenuBar:hover ul a
		{
        color: #fff;
        font-size:110%;
        font-weight:normal;
		}
    #MenuBar:hover ul a:hover
		{
        color: #003399;
        background: #ccc;
        color: #000 !important;
        display: block;
        width: 100%;
        padding: 5px 10px;
		}
    #MenuBar ul
		{
        display: none;
		}
    #MenuBar ul a
		{
        padding: 5px 10px;
        border-bottom: 1px solid #666;
        width: 100%;
		}
    #MenuBar li
		{
        float: none;
        overflow: hidden;
		}
    #MenuBar .H_seprateLine:after
		{
        content: "";
		}
    #more_articles .Control_04 > h3
		{
        margin: 20px 10px;
		}
	#Gallery
		{
		height:300px;
		}
	#Gallery .BTN-goto_gallery
		{		
		left: 23%;
		}
	#TopArticles .slider .btns
	    {
	    display:none
	    }
    #right #TopArticles .slider .SliderInnerItems
        {
        width:100% !important;
        min-width:1px;
        }
    #right #TopArticles .slider 
        {
        width:100%;
        height: auto;
        }
    .slider .SliderInnerItems > a
        {
        width:100%;
        float:none;
        }
    .SliderInnerItems .Control_01 > img
        {
        float: none;
        height:auto;            
        }
    #TopArticles .Control_01 .subtitle 
        {
        font-size: 130%;
        line-height:150%;
        width: 100%;
        display: block;
        margin-bottom: 3em;
        }
    .deotNav
        {
        display:none;
        }
    #main #right .AllDeotElementsBox > div        
        {
        width:100%; 
        position:static;
        }
    .AllDeotElementsBox .DeotElement 
        {
        direction: rtl;
        float: none;
        overflow: hidden;
        background: none;
        padding-left: 0;
        margin:0 0 25px;
        height:auto;
        display:block;
        }        
    .DeotElement > span 
        {
        display:block;
        float:right;
        width:185px;
        }
   .DeotElement .DeotAuthor
        {
        display:block;
        }
    #deot        
        {
        height:auto !important;
        }
    .AllDeotElementsBox 
        {
        position: static;
        display: block;
        width: 100%;
        height:auto;
        }
    .more_articles .Control_01 > img 
        {
        margin-left: 0;
        float: none;
        width: 200px;
        height: 150px;
        display: block;
        margin: 0 auto 2em;
        }
    .more_articles .Control_01 .title 
        {
        display: inline-block;
        font: bold 180% arial;
        overflow: hidden;
        width: 96%;
        margin: 0 0 20px;
        float: none;
        }
    .more_articles .Control_01 .subtitle 
        {
        display: inline-block;
        float: none;
        font: normal 125%/20px arial;
        overflow: hidden;
        width: 96%;
        margin-bottom: 10px;
        }
    .more_articles a.Control_01 
        {
        display: block;
        overflow: hidden;
        width: 90%;
        color: #000;
        text-decoration: none;
        margin: 0 auto 30px;
        }   
    a.BTNs 
        {
        background: #D5EEEA;
        border-radius: 0;
        color: #1E4A61 !important;
        display: block;
        font: normal 22px arial;
        height: auto;
        padding: 5px 10px;
        text-align: center;
        vertical-align: middle;
        width: 80%;
        border: 1px solid #B4D1CC;
        margin: 0 auto 30px;     
        }
   #main #left 
        {
        width: 96%;
        float: none;
        display: block;
        margin: 0 auto;
        padding: 0 2%;
        }
    #madrih 
        {
        border-bottom: 1px solid #EFEFEF;
        }
   #NewsletterBox 
        {
        background: #EEF8F6;
        display: block;
        width:100%;
        float: right;
        }
   #MadorArticles .Control_04
       {
       width:100%;
       }
    #MadorArticles .Control_04 h3 > a > img       
        {
        width:100%;
        height:auto;
        }
    #MadorArticles .Control_04 .title, #MadorArticles .Control_04 .subtitle
        {
        width: 100%;
        max-width:none;
        min-height:0;
        }        
    .more_articles .Control_06 > a
        {
        width: 200px;
        height: 150px;
        float: none;
        margin: 0 auto 15px;
        overflow: hidden;
        display: block;
        }
    .more_articles .Control_06 
        {
        display: block;
        overflow: hidden;
        width: 80%;
        margin: 0 auto 30px;
        clear: none;
        }
   .more_articles .Control_08
        {
        margin-bottom:10px;
        }
    .more_articles .Control_08 .element_data
        {
        display: block;
        overflow: hidden;
        float: none;
        border: 1px solid rgba(255, 255, 255, 0);
        margin: 10px 0;
        }
    .more_articles .Control_08 > a
        {
        float: none;
        width: 100%;
        max-width: none;
        margin: 10px 0;
        display: block;
        }
    #VSubject
        {
        width: 95% !important;
        }
    #main .control_box        
        {
              overflow: hidden !important;
        }
        
    #secArtilces .Control_08 img,.more_articles1 .item .showIndex img,.more_articles .Control_08 > a img {width:100%; height:auto}      
    #secArtilces,.more_articles1 .item .showIndex { width:100%; float:none}  
    #TopArticles { margin-bottom:20px}
    #secArtilces,.more_articles1 .item .showIndex {margin-bottom:20px; display:block}
    
    
             
}


@media only screen and (max-width: 480px)  
{
    #htmlHead .ads1 div[id^='div-gpt-ad'] { display:block !important} 
    .ads1 { position:relative;top:0;right:0; z-index:1111}  
    #closeBtn { position:relative; top:0;left:0}
    #closeInnerBtn  { position:absolute; left:0; background:url("http://images.globes.co.il/images/site2/special_projects/leeMarshel/closeBTN.png") 0 0; width:54px; height:54px}
    #articles #LogoBox { margin-top:100px !important; height:60px !important}
    #articles #right { margin-top:0 !important}
    #middleBanner { display:none}
    #main #LogoBox {margin-top:60px !important;}
    .youtubeItemsBigImg img { width:100%}
    #main .control_box { max-width:100%}
    .YouTubeBox:after { left:43%}
    .header {
    background: rgba(0, 0, 0, 0) url("http://images.globes.co.il/images/m/header_bg.png") repeat-x scroll 0 0;
    display: block !important;
    height: 45px;
    left: 0;
    position: fixed;
    top: 0;
    width: 100%;
}
.header .logo {
    border: 0 none;
    display: block;
    margin: 7px auto;
    overflow: hidden;
    width: 83px;
}
.header .goBack {
    cursor: pointer;
    height: 12px;
    position: relative;
    right: 10px;
    top: -27px;
    width: 8px;
}


  }    
    
